South Indian food has always been my favourite and I never miss out going to a place that serves South Indian delicacies primarily....Curry leaf serves a wide range of South Indian food along with few North Indian dishes as well ...Beverages are also there....I tried: VIP masala dosa {plain}= it was crispy and nicely made , served along with sambhar , coconut ,mint and red chilli coconut chutney...Sambhar was good in taste with apt consistency, neither too thick nor too thin.....Chutneys were average to bland in taste{watery I can say}.
2.Chilli Idli: idli with desi chinese touch...excess use of sauces overpowered the taste of idli but if you love spicy and saucy stuffs then may be you'll like it...
South Indian Thali: It carried a mini dosa, one piece idli and 2 pieces of medu vada along with sambhar and chutneys..Dosa stuffing carried over turmeric and tasted a bit bland...medu vada was nice in taste{soft and properly made} and idli also was fine...
Malabar paratha with veg korma= Malabar paratha was beautifully made where you can see the spirals , tasted nice but Veg korma seemed as if sambhar was made creamier and served as such as sambhar taste was very powering and didn't tasted like korma...You can see the picture..
Payassam: it was sweet vermicilli{ meethi sewai} in milk topped with nuts...Sugar was a bit excess...Tasted average...Taste and appearance both would have been enhanced if they would have used saffron{ widely used in making payassam } in it...
Ambience is beautiful with large seating area ...Good for group outings...Lightings are amazing and so is their furniture...Staff who was attending us was attentive {consistently coming up and filling our glasses and clearing table of the dishes we have finished} and service...

Read moreCurry Leaf is a South Indian delicacy chain, they also serve Veg North Indian cuisine.
What I liked: -Comfortable seating and cooling -Menu options -Location -Prompt service -Pricing
What I disliked -untrained staff
I ordered this VIP Masala Dosa which costed ₹290, for the size price seemed justifiable. It can easily be shared among 3. The plain dosa was obviously real crisp and different chutneys tasted good but that's that. Aloo filling was bland, there were big chunks of aloo. Sambar was of thin consistency, personal I didn't like the taste of it.Cutlery disaster, if you're serving something different then please serve it in an appropriate platter. I also ordered Peach Iced Tea, Red Velvet Shakes and Pav Bhaji; these were fine.
What I disliked most was their staff behaviour, we were in the middle of giving orders but got into a discussion for a bit and the waiter left the table and was busy using phone. Like seriously. 🙄 If it was that urgent he could have excused after all job's a job.
Anyway my experience wasn't that bad but then not good...
